Abstract
The invention discloses a novel perfume pump, which comprises a pump body extending into a bottle body, wherein a pump chamber is arranged on the pump body, a suction assembly is arranged in the pump chamber, a locking cover is detachably connected to the upper end of the pump body, and an alumina bayonet is further arranged on the pump body; the pumping assembly comprises an upper pump rod, a liquid outlet is formed in the upper pump rod, a pumping plug is further arranged on the upper pump rod, a valve core is further arranged in the pump chamber, a piston is sleeved on the valve core, a liquid storage cavity is formed between the pumping plug and the piston in the pump chamber, a communication channel is formed between the piston and the inner wall of the pump chamber, and a blocking structure is further arranged between the piston and the inner wall of the pump chamber; the lower extreme of case is provided with the spring, is provided with the button on the upper pump rod. The invention has simple structure, eliminates the traditional structure of adopting the pump bead as the one-way valve, can ensure that the perfume pump can be used at different angles through the matching of the piston and the valve core and the matching of the piston and the inner wall of the pump chamber, is not limited by the position, is convenient to use, reduces parts and reduces the cost.
Description
[ field of technology ]
The invention relates to a micro sprayer, in particular to a novel perfume pump.
[ background Art ]
Currently, many micro-sprayers are sold on the market, and the micro-sprayers can atomize and spray the liquid in the container by pressing a button or a spray head; the working principle is as follows: the piston moves in the pump body by utilizing the atmospheric pressure balance principle, so that the gas in the pump body flows, the pressure intensity is reduced, the pressure intensity outside the pump body is unchanged, the pressure difference is generated between the inside and the outside of the pump body, the liquid is guided out of the pump body by the pressure difference, and the liquid is instantaneously atomized when the liquid encounters high-speed airflow; i.e. using bernoulli's principle: the flow rate is high and the pressure is low in the same fluid; the flow rate is small and the pressure is high. These sprayer products are widely used in the fields of flower growing, hair salons, cosmetics, etc., some of which press the head cap of the micro-sprayer, mainly used for perfume spraying in the cosmetic field, or called perfume pump. The perfume pump is generally installed at an opening of the container for discharging the liquid in the container for use by a manual pressing operation of a user.
However, the existing perfume pump has more components, complex structure and increased production cost, and the locking cover is fixedly connected with the pump body, so that the spraying amount is fixed, the spraying amount cannot be adjusted, and the bursting force is poor; and when using, can only be with the pump body vertical placing earlier, just can be through pressing the liquid blowout in the button with the bottle, it is very inconvenient to use, and user experience feels relatively poor.
The present invention has been made in view of the above-described drawbacks.

[ detailed description ] of the invention
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the accompanying drawings in the embodiments of the present invention.
As shown in fig. 1 to 7, a novel perfume pump comprises a pump body 1 extending into a bottle body, wherein the pump body 1 is provided with a pump chamber 2, a suction assembly 3 capable of moving up and down in the pump chamber 2 to suck liquid in the bottle body upwards is arranged in the pump chamber 2, a locking cover 4 capable of preventing the suction assembly 3 from being separated from the pump chamber 2 is detachably connected to the pump body 1 and positioned at the upper end of the pump chamber 2, and an alumina bayonet 5 capable of fixing the pump body 1 to the bottle body is also arranged on the pump body 1; the suction assembly 3 comprises an upper pump rod 31 which can pass through the locking cover 4 and is provided with a suction channel 311, a liquid outlet 312 which is communicated with the suction channel 311 is formed in the upper pump rod 31, a suction plug 32 which is in sliding sealing with the inner wall of the pump chamber 2 is further arranged on the upper pump rod 31, a valve core 33 which can seal the liquid outlet 312 and can open the liquid outlet 312 when the upper pump rod 31 moves downwards is also arranged in the pump chamber 2, when the upper pump rod moves downwards, the upper pump rod is extruded in the pump chamber, the air pressure is suddenly increased, and at the moment, the valve core can generate a gap with the upper pump rod when the upper pump rod moves downwards, and then the liquid outlet is opened to enable liquid to be sprayed out from the liquid outlet; the valve core 33 is sleeved with a piston 6 which can be driven by the valve core 33 to move up and down, a liquid storage cavity 201 is formed in the pump chamber 2 and between the suction plug 32 and the piston 6, a communication channel 601 which can be used for communicating liquid in the bottle body with the liquid storage cavity 201 is arranged between the piston 6 and the inner wall of the pump chamber 2, and a blocking structure which can be used for blocking the liquid in the bottle body and the liquid storage cavity 201 when the piston 6 is pushed by the valve core 33 to move downwards is arranged between the piston 6 and the inner wall of the pump chamber 2; the lower end of the valve core 33 is provided with a spring 34 which can keep the upper end of the valve core 33 in the suction channel 311 so as to block the liquid outlet 312 from discharging, and the upper pump rod 31 is provided with a button 7. The invention has simple structure, abandons the traditional structure of adopting the pump bead as a one-way valve, and forms a liquid storage cavity between the piston and the suction plug by arranging the piston which can be driven by the valve core to move up and down in the pump chamber, a communication channel which can be communicated with liquid in the bottle body and the liquid storage cavity is arranged between the piston and the inner wall of the pump chamber, a blocking structure which can block the liquid in the bottle body and the liquid storage cavity when the piston is pushed by the valve core to move downwards is also arranged between the piston and the inner wall of the pump chamber, and the perfume pump can be used at different angles by the cooperation of the piston, the valve core and the piston and the inner wall of the pump chamber, so that the perfume pump is not limited by the position, the use is convenient, the parts are reduced, and the cost is reduced; meanwhile, the locking cover is detachably connected with the pump body, the rebound height of the suction assembly can be adjusted by replacing the locking cover, so that the ejection quantity of liquid is adjusted, the requirements of different customers are met, the product is serialized, the structure is simple, and the cost is low.
As shown in fig. 1 to 7, in this embodiment, the blocking structure includes an annular boss 21 provided on an inner wall of the pump chamber 2, the piston 6 includes a body 61, an annular flange 611 capable of abutting against the annular boss 21 to seal when the piston moves downward is provided at an upper end of the body 61, when the valve core 33 drives the piston to move downward, the annular flange 611 on the body 61 abuts against the annular boss 21 to seal the liquid storage cavity 201, and when the pump rod is continuously pressed down, a gap is formed between the valve core and the upper pump rod due to the extrusion of the suction plug to the liquid storage cavity, and liquid in the liquid storage cavity is ejected from the liquid outlet.
As shown in fig. 1 to 7, in this embodiment, an annular flange 612 capable of being in abutting fit with the annular boss 21 is provided at the lower end of the body 61, and a plurality of grooves 613 recessed toward the inner side of the body are provided on the annular flange 612, and the grooves 613 and the annular boss 21 enclose the communication channel 601. When the upper pump rod moves upwards, the valve core rises under the action of the elastic force of the spring, and then the piston is driven to move upwards, and at the moment, the communication channel 601 between the piston and the pump chamber is opened.
As shown in fig. 1 to 7, in this embodiment, a ring of annular protruding blocks 41 are disposed on the outer side of the lower end of the locking cover 4, a clamping groove 11 into which the annular protruding blocks 41 can be clamped is disposed on the inner side wall of the upper end of the pump body 1, and a bearing edge 42 capable of propping against the upper end of the pump body 1 is further disposed on the locking cover 4. By adopting the structure, the locking cover is convenient to detach from the pump body, after the locking cover is replaced, the rebound height of the pumping assembly after pressing can be changed due to the change of the structure of the locking cover, so that the spraying quantity of liquid can be adjusted, the requirements of different clients can be met, the product is serialized, the structure is simple, and the cost is low.
As shown in fig. 1 to 7, in the present embodiment, a vent hole 12 is formed on the side wall of the pump body 1 and above the piston 6. The pressure in the bottle body can be kept consistent with the pressure outside the bottle body.
As shown in fig. 1 to 7, in the present embodiment, a positioning groove 331 into which one end of the spring 34 extends is formed in the valve core 33; the positioning groove is arranged to prevent the spring from deviating, so that the structure is stable.
As shown in fig. 1 to 7, in the present embodiment, the upper pump rod 31 and the suction plug 32 are integrally formed, so that the product structure is simplified.
As shown in fig. 1 to 7, in this embodiment, the button 7 includes a guide portion 71 fixedly connected to the upper pump rod 31, and an alumina outer cover 72 is sleeved on the outside of the guide portion 71. Visual fatigue can be avoided by replacing the alumina outer cover.
As shown in fig. 1 to 7, in this embodiment, a liquid guiding tube 8 is further disposed below the pump body 1.
As shown in fig. 1 to 7, in this embodiment, a gasket 9 is further disposed in the alumina bayonet 5; preventing leakage of liquid.
When the pump is used, the button is pressed downwards, the suction assembly moves downwards along with the button, the upper pump rod drives the valve core to move downwards, the valve core is connected with the piston in a sliding sealing way, liquid below the piston can move upwards along a communication channel between the piston and the pump chamber to enter the liquid storage cavity, the piston moves downwards along with the valve core, the annular flange 611 on the body 61 can be abutted against the annular boss 21 and seal the liquid storage cavity 201, the pressure in the liquid storage cavity is continuously increased due to the extrusion of the suction plug to the liquid storage cavity in the process of continuously pressing the pump rod, the suction plug can be always abutted against the upper end of the piston to place the piston to move upwards due to overlarge pressure, at the moment, gaps are formed between the valve core and the upper pump rod due to the instant increase of the pressure in the liquid storage cavity, and the liquid in the liquid storage cavity is sprayed out from the liquid outlet.
